Sergiu Celibidache

Romanian conductor, composer, and teacher (1912–1996) whose career in music spanned over five decades and included tenures as principal conductor for the Munich Philharmonic and the Berlin Philharmonic. TLS, one onionskin page, 7.25 x 10.5, personal letterhead, February 2, 1962. In full: “Much to my surprise I have learnt that my letter to you dated January 28, 1962, has not yet been published in your paper. If I do not receive satisfaction I shall have to consider taking legal steps.” In fine condition, with the letterhead underlined in red ink by an unknown hand. Pre-certified PSA/DNA.
